Key Betting Terminology Explained

Before diving into sports betting, it’s essential to grasp some common terminology. This includes terms such as “line” (the spread or odds set by bookmakers), “over/under” (betting on a combined score exceeding or falling short of a set number), and “moneyline” (odds reflecting the probability of a team winning outright). Understanding these terms will help new bettors navigate the betting landscape more effectively.

Differentiating Between Betting Types

There are various betting types to consider, including straight bets, parlays, and teasers. A straight bet involves wagering on a single event, while parlays combine multiple bets into one. Teasers allow bettors to adjust point spreads, offering flexibility. Each type has its specific risk and reward profile, making it crucial for bettors to choose wisely based on their strategy and risk tolerance.

Effective Bankroll Management Techniques

Successful betting hinges on effective bankroll management. Players should set a dedicated budget for their betting activities and adhere strictly to it. A common technique is the “unit” system, where each bet represents a set percentage of the total bankroll, helping to mitigate risk. Additionally, setting loss limits ensures gamblers do not chase losses, promoting responsible gaming habits.

Identifying Value Bets in Sports Markets

Value betting is crucial for long-term profitability in sports betting. A value bet occurs when the probability of a specific outcome is greater than what the odds reflect. To find these bets, players should conduct thorough research, considering factors like team form, injuries, weather conditions, and historical matchups. Analyzing these elements can provide the insight necessary to uncover profitable betting opportunities.

Understanding Performance Metrics

Performance metrics such as player stats, goal averages, and defensive rankings are fundamental in shaping betting decisions. Bettors should familiarize themselves with relevant metrics for the particular sport they are betting on. For example, in football betting, metrics like “xG” (expected goals) can reveal how well a team performs in converting chances, which is pivotal for identifying potential outcomes.

Identifying Problem Gambling Signs

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is critical. Common indicators include increasing preoccupation with gambling, neglecting personal relationships, or chasing losses. Should any of these signs become apparent, it is essential for individuals to seek assistance.

Resources for Responsible Gaming Practices

Mental health support and responsible gaming resources, such as self-exclusion programs, are available for individuals who may require them. Many jurisdictions offer support organizations that provide guidance, information, and counseling for those struggling with gambling-related issues.
